Description

Papas fritas sabor barbacoa is listed here under EAN 7792052177375. Its ingredient declaration covers 8 entries. Pack size is given as 140 g. It carries a Nutri-Score of D. A 100 g portion carries 488 kcal (2040 kJ). It also supplies 28.4 g of fat, 3.2 g of it saturated, 52 g of carbohydrate, including 2.8 g of sugars, 6 g of protein, 8.4 g of fibre and 1.87 g of salt per 100 g. Origin is given as Argentina. Labelling claims on file include no gluten.

Ingredients

Harina de papa deshidratada (papa deshidratada en polvo, emulsificante (INS 471), acidulante (INS 330)), aceite de girasol alto oleico, almidón de papa, harina de maíz, sal, aromatizante (identico al natural sabor barbacoa), potenciador de sabor (INS 621)
